World Cup champion in 2023, German big man Daniel Theis officially signed with AS Monaco until the end of 2025-2026 season, after eight seasons in the NBA.

He signed a contract that will keep him in Monaco until the end of 2025-26 season.
Per Basketnews sources, Monaco did not submit the highest financial offer, as Panathinaikos AKTOR Athens put forth the most lucrative proposal.
Another mid-table EuroLeague club also expressed interest and was prepared to make a significant offer, per sources.
Theis also received offers from NBA teams but was seeking a situation where he could play a larger role, sources tell BasketNews.
Before leaving for the NBA to join Boston Celtics, Daniel Theis spent three seasons with Brose Bamberg in Germany, where he made his debut in the Euroleague.
Over eight NBA seasons, he appeared in 411 games for the Celtics, Chicago Bulls, Indiana Pacers, Los Angeles Clippers, and New Orleans Pelicans, averaging 7.1 points, 4.7 rebounds, and 1.3 assists in 18.8 minutes per game.
